Output 506f8bb73924227ad18b6ddb2eba399d876a0c96e17ea66c02721777d08a5d82:6

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b8989c44900ae571fbf6c5a8db44f1aafad2f83b82be4d726f980308a166a2d2
address
tb1phzvfc3ysptjhr7lkck5dk3834tad97pms2ly6un0nqps3gtx5tfqs5ymrt
transaction
506f8bb73924227ad18b6ddb2eba399d876a0c96e17ea66c02721777d08a5d82